Emsworth to Wilnecote (Staffs) by train

A train trip from Emsworth to Wilnecote (Staffs) takes about 5hrs 6 mins on average, covering roughly 125 miles (202 kilometres). With around 19 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£13.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Emsworth to Wilnecote (Staffs) start from as little as £13.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Emsworth to Wilnecote (Staffs) start from £70.90 one way, or £101.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Emsworth to Wilnecote (Staffs) are available for £114.30 one way, or £228.40 return

Facilities and Amenities

Emsworth Station prides itself on a range of essential facilities, 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open daily with slightly different hours on weekdays and weekends, and there are ticket machines available for those needing to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y on-the-go. Despite its modest size, the station doesn’t compromise on accessibility. Although it lacks a waiting room and accessible toilets, it offers step-free access via long ramps and staff-operated ramps for train access. Assistance is readily available, ensuring everyone can travel comfortably.

For convenience, smartcard validators are present, and induction loops ensure inclusivity for hearing-impaired travelers. Though you won’t find an ATM or shops within the station, the essential comfort features like a seating area and accessible ticket machines are in place. Rest assured, your safety is a priority with CCTV monitoring both the station and the bicycle storage area.

Facilities and Amenities at Wilnecote (Staffs)

Wilnecote (Staffs) station is minimalistic with no ticket office on-site. However, ticket machines are available for quick collection, simplifying your travel needs. For those requiring accessibility options, the station offers step-free access in certain areas, though it’s advisable to verify specifics before travel. Assistance is on hand through customer help points available on the platform.

Although Wi-Fi and refreshment services aren't available, the station accommodates some basic needs with seating areas, and the availability of induction loops for passengers who are hard of hearing. Despite the lack of extensive facilities, Wilnecote (Staffs) remains effective in supporting straightforward travel requirements.
